Output 16a90aba0b08a1909aa24e1b0d19bcb479309bdfcf3d633dd562a6e52aa211d1:0

value
5143915
script pubkey
OP_0 OP_PUSHBYTES_20 8577f1a49d2eeea6e20f56de7666e64727557b42
address
bc1qs4mlrfya9mh2dcs02m08vehxgun4276z56r6my
transaction
16a90aba0b08a1909aa24e1b0d19bcb479309bdfcf3d633dd562a6e52aa211d1
confirmations
152565
spent
true